in a word... you don't. you would have to run new romex (ie wire) rated for the amperage you wanna carry. that would most likely require some demo'ing of walls depending on how your home is setup. possibly replace each outlet with ones rated to handle 20 or 25 amp load (your std wall outlet is only 15amp). also upgrade the breaker to match.... In other words, the whole system works together, and you can only carry (safely) as much load as your weakest link. thats why you can't just pop in a higher breaker without considering the existing wiring, etc.

In summery, you would pay an electrican a far amount of money to do this. In most cases, it would be far cheaper to have a new circuit run to carry the load you need than to try and bring an existing one up to the task.
